  10. Saw this on another Venture site. Honda Motor Company announced its plans for the new 2009 GL-2000 Goldwing The new 2009 Goldwing will replace the industry-leading GL-1800 Goldwing which went into production in 2001. The 2009 GL-2000 Goldwing will feature a larger 2.0 litre (2000 cc) 6-cylinder engine matched to a new 6-speed transmission. Honda claims the new engine will produce 165 horsepower and 157 foot pounds of torque. "This new powerplant and transmission should provide the kind of power and torque Goldwing owners have come to expect" a company official says. With the new 6-speed transmission, the 2.0 liter engine turns only 2,500 rpm at 70 miles per hour. The new Goldwing will increase the safety of its riders with standard ABS brakes on all 2009 models. A rider airbag is also available as an option on the level 4 model. The 2009 GL-2000 will be offered in the following configurations: Standard features on all 2009 GL-2000 Goldwing models: - New 2000cc 6-cylinder engine with 6-Speed transmission - Linked ABS brakes (front and rear) - Dramatically improved suspension with adjustable pre-load front and rear - 6.9 gallon fuel capacity - Adjustable seat (can be raised/lowered up to 1.5 inches) and rider backrest can be moved forward/backward. - Adjustable windscreen (electronically adjustable is optional) - Cargo capacity has been increased to 45 liters per saddlebag and 65 litres for the trunk. - Heated handgrips and heated seat - L.E.D. tail/brake lights and lighted trunk spoiler - New instrument cluster includes speedo/tach/engine temp/voltage/ambient temp/gear indicator/tire pressure/trip computer (see below) - DC Accessory Outlet in dash glovebox - Trip Computer displays: Miles to Empty/Avg Miles Per Gallon/Current Miles Per Gallon -Intercom features improved audio quality and passenger volume/on/off switch -Honda Warranty 3-year Unlimited Miles (up to 4 year optional extended warranty) BASE MODEL - includes comfort package (heated handgrips and seat), ABS brakes front and rear, 85-watt 4-speaker stereo with MP3/iPod connector. COMFORT PACKAGE - includes BASE model features + electonically controlled windscreen, Homelink remote garage door opener, integrated anti-theft device. $20,499 PREMIUM PACKAGE- includes all comfort package features + 120-watt 4-speaker stereo with MP3/iPod connection/optional XM/SIRIUS radio/Bluetooth capability, Electronic tire pressure monitoring system, integrated NAVI navigation system with Bluetooth remote programming capability using MapSource and compatible laptop, integrated fog/driving lights, HID Xenon headlights. SAFETY PLUS PACKAGE - includes all PREMIUM features + Rider SRS Airbag restraint system, rear-end collision proximity alert system, electonically controlled cruise control. In addition, the completely re-designed Goldwing offers owners lower maintenance costs with easier access to regular maintenance areas such as air cleaner, oil drain plug, oil filter and oil dipstick. A quick-remove engine protector plate has also been added to guard the oil pan from potential damage caused my road debris. The new Goldwing is expected to appear in dealer showrooms in September 2008 and will be offered in the following colors: Pearl White, Pearl Yellow, Pearl Orange, Illusion Blue, Black, Titanium and Illusion Red.
